在移动互联网应用的广阔天地里,计算机硬件无疑是支撑这一切的“心脏”,而在这颗“心脏”中,CPU(中央处理器)无疑是其最核心的部分,是什么决定了CPU的性能?是架构还是制程工艺?
回答:
CPU的性能,从根本上讲,是由其架构和制程工艺共同决定的,但若要深入探讨,架构的选择往往在初期就为CPU的性能奠定了基调。
架构之争:CISC与RISC
在计算机硬件的早期,CISC(复杂指令集计算机)和RISC(精简指令集计算机)是两种主要的CPU架构,CISC试图通过增加指令集的复杂性来提高性能,但这也带来了指令执行效率低、功耗高等问题,而RISC则通过简化指令集、增加寄存器数量等手段,实现了更高的指令执行效率和更低的功耗,随着技术的发展,RISC架构逐渐成为主流,尤其是在移动设备中,如ARM架构的CPU。
架构的进化:x86与ARM的较量
在个人电脑领域,x86架构长期占据主导地位,随着移动互联网的兴起,ARM架构凭借其低功耗、高性能的特点,逐渐在移动设备中崭露头角,x86与ARM的较量,不仅仅是两种架构之间的竞争,更是两种不同设计理念和市场需求之间的碰撞。
制程工艺的推动
除了架构的选择外,制程工艺的进步也是推动CPU性能提升的关键因素,从早期的微米级制程到现在的纳米级制程,制程工艺的不断缩小使得单位面积内可以容纳更多的晶体管,从而提高了CPU的运算速度和能效比,制程工艺的进步也面临着物理极限的挑战,如何突破这一瓶颈,将是未来计算机硬件领域的重要课题。
CPU的性能并非单一因素所能决定,而是架构、制程工艺以及设计理念等多方面因素共同作用的结果,在移动互联网应用日益丰富的今天,对计算机硬件尤其是CPU的研究和探索,将不断推动着技术的进步和应用的创新。
添加新评论